Imininingwane Yobuchwepheshe
| Isici | Inani (Elijwayelekile) |
| Ukwakheka Kwamakhemikhali (wt%) | Cu: 76-78%; Inani: 22-24%; I-Fe: ≤0.5%; UMn: ≤0.8%; Isimo: ≤0.1%; C: ≤0.05% |
| Ububanzi Bokujiya | 0.01mm – 2.0mm (ukubekezelela: ±0.001mm ngo-≤0.1mm; ±0.005mm ngo->0.1mm) |
| Ububanzi Bebanga | 5mm – 600mm (ukubekezelela: ±0.05mm ngo-≤100mm; ±0.1mm ngo->100mm) |
| Izinketho Zesimo Sengqondo | Ithambile (ifakwe uhhafu), Iqinile (igoqwe ngokubandayo) |
| Amandla Okudonsa | Ithambile: 350-400 MPa; Ukuqina okuyingxenye: 450-500 MPa; Ukuqina: 550-600 MPa |
| Amandla Okukhiqiza | Ithambile: 120-150 MPa; Ukuqina okuyingxenye: 300-350 MPa; Ukuqina: 450-500 MPa |
| Ukwelulwa (25°C) | Okuthambile: ≥30%; Ukuqina okuyingxenye: 15-25%; Okuqinile: ≤10% |
| Ubulukhuni (HV) | Okuthambile: 90-110; Ukuqina okuyingxenye: 130-150; Ukuqina: 170-190 |
| Ukumelana (20°C) | 35-38 μΩ·cm |
| Ukushisa Okuphezulu (20°C) | 45 W/(m·K) |
| Ibanga Lokushisa Lokusebenza | -50°C kuya ku-250°C (ukusetshenziswa okuqhubekayo) |

Izicelo Ezijwayelekile
- Izingxenye Zikagesi: Ama-resistor aphakathi kokunemba, ama-current shunts, kanye nezinto ze-potentiometer—lapho ukumelana okulinganiselayo kanye nezindleko kubalulekile khona.
- Ihadiwe Yasolwandle Neyasogwini: Ukufakwa kwezikebhe, iziqu zamavalvu, kanye nezindawo zokuzwa—ezimelana nokugqwala kwamanzi anosawoti ngaphandle kwezindleko ze-alloy ezinama-nickel amaningi.
- Ukuhlobisa Nokwakha: Amapuleti egama, ukuhlobisa izinto zikagesi, kanye nezimpawu zokwakha—ukukhanya kwesiliva nokumelana nokugqwala kususa izidingo zokuhlobisa.
- Izinzwa Namathuluzi: Izintambo zokunciphisa i-thermocouple kanye ne-strain gauge substrates—izakhiwo zikagesi ezizinzile ziqinisekisa ukunemba kokulinganisa.
- Izimoto: Ama-terminal okuxhuma kanye nezinto ezincane zokushisa—kuhlanganisa ukwakheka kahle nokumelana nomswakama ongaphansi.
